Default Seed mixture for syrians

Hello! I have a question about syrian food mixes. Specifically i'm planning to do a mix between Higgins Sunburst food as well as Mazuri Rat & Mouse pellets for the added protein. I've been watching alot of a hamster channel and they suggested feeding a syrian every other day one tablespoon of food. What i'm wondering is how many pellets should be put into the food every other day? As they are fairly large i didn't know if it should be one every other day or more.


The pellet nutrition is Protein : 23% Fat : 6.50% Fiber : 4.5%
The sunburst is Protein : 14.00% Fat: 7.00% Fiber 9.50%

Default Re: Seed mixture for syrians

Do not use Higgins Sunburst. Higgins Sunburst has way too much dried fruit. You would need Higgins Vita Garden which is a much better food, as well as not feeding this food with lab blocks at all. Despite past popularity, Higgins Sunburst and Mazuri is really not a great diet - stick with 100% Higgins Vita Garden!

Default Re: Seed mixture for syrians

I feed my Syrian a table spoon of his mix daily because a hamster needs to have enough food available to keep a hoard or two. Don't be guided by what you can see they eat because they often eat from their hoards while in their nest.

I also don't believe in waiting until the food bowl is empty before refilling it. I chuck food out that's not been eaten after a couple of days and refill with fresh.

Please keep in mind that this is only my opinion and what i do which may well differ from other people but it's always helpful to hear different takes on matters then draw your own conclusions and do what works best for your hamster.
